Personalização de gesto

Última atualização em 2023-12-07

É possível personalizar os gestos do aplicativo AEM Forms para fornecer um método distinto de interação com o aplicativo. Por exemplo, é possível adicionar novos gestos para abrir ou fechar uma tarefa ou um ponto inicial.

Para personalizar gestos no aplicativo AEM Forms

No aplicativo AEM Forms, o deslizamento para a esquerda abre uma nova tarefa ou um ponto inicial, enquanto o deslizamento para a direita não faz nada. O exemplo a seguir fornece etapas para abrir uma nova tarefa ou ponto de partida ao executar os gestos de deslizar com o botão direito do mouse no aplicativo AEM Forms.

  1. Abra o projeto.

    • Para o iOS, abra Capture.xcodeproj no Xcode
    • Para Android, abra o projeto Android no Eclipse.
    • Para Windows, abra MWSWindows.sln no Visual Studio.
  2. Navegue até a pasta de exibições e abra a task.js arquivo para edição.

    • No XCode, navegue até a guia Capture > www > wsmobile > js > tempo de execução > exibições pasta.
    • No Eclipse, navegue até o ativos > www > wsmobile > js > tempo de execução > exibições pasta.
    • No Visual Studio, navegue até o MWSWindows > www > wsmobile > js > tempo de execução > exibições pasta.
    OBSERVAÇÃO

    O arquivo task.js contém a exibição de backbone associada a cada tarefa ou Startpoint listado nas listas tarefa ou Startpoint.

  3. No task.js arquivo, procure a propriedade events da visualização.

    A propriedade events é um mapa com cada entrada no formato:

    "EventName Selector": "Function"

    Quando você aciona um evento JavaScript chamado EventNameem um elemento HTML especificado por Selector, o Functioné chamado.

  4. Localizar

    • "select .taskContentArea" : "onTaskClick",

      "select .taskOpenArea" : "onTaskClick",

      "select .task-content" : "onTaskClick",

      "select .last_empty_div" : "onTaskClick",

    e substitua por

    • "swipe .taskContentArea" : "onTaskClick",

      "swipe .taskOpenArea" : "onTaskClick",

      "swipe .task-content" : "onTaskClick",

      "swipe .last_empty_div" : "onTaskClick",

  5. Salve e feche o task.js arquivo.

  6. Crie e execute o aplicativo AEM Forms. Agora você pode abrir um usando o com o deslizamento para a esquerda e para a direita.

Da mesma forma, é possível fazer alterações em outras exibições para várias combinações de gestos, elementos HTML e funções.

Nesta página